1888 Charles Spurgeon Types & Emblems Puritan Baptist Night Sermons Tabernacle
“Oh, that something would move this great city of ours! I am afraid that at least one-third of our population is settling down in stolid indifference to all religion.”
― C.H. Spurgeon, An Exiting Enquiry, a sermon
A rare, late 19th-century printing of the Puritan sermons of Charles H Spurgeon collected into a work entitled “Types and Emblems” and includes sermons with the aim: to arouse the energy and direct the efforts of Christian workers. This is an uncommon edition of Spurgeon’s sermons on Sunday and Thursday nights, done in the Metropolitan Tabernacle where he was Pastor from 1854-92.
This 1888 edition of ‘Types and Emblems’ includes sermons:
- The Star of Jacob
- Royal Emblems for Loyal Subjects
- A Frail Leaf
- The Helmet
- Christ the Tree of Life
- Women’s Rights – A Parable
- David’s First Victory
- And More
